Claim Petition

If your employer refuses to accept your claim under the workers' compensation system, you may need to file a Claim Petitition. This is a formal document that is filed with the Bureau of Workers Compensation in the county you reside in or the area in which your employer has its headquarters.

This petition contains specific information about your injury, including the manner in which it happened. It also lists the medical claims you have made and your wage loss.

After the Claim Petition is received the case will be assigned to a judge at the nearest workers' compensation court. The judge will then schedule a hearing. The first hearing usually happens in the weeks following the petition is filed.

The next step of the Claim Petition process is the discovery phase. In this phase, you and your attorney will have the opportunity to meet with witnesses and gather evidence.

Mandatory Mediation

The parties to a worker's compensation case (the Employer or the injured worker) must participate in a mediation process prior to the case is brought to trial. However, the parties are able to agree to take part in a mediation process prior to the initial hearing.

The mediator brings together the injured worker, his attorney, and the employer's insurance agent or attorney. Each party gets the chance to speak up after the mediator reviews the facts of the case.

The parties are encouraged to discuss all points of disagreement and consider the other's viewpoints. If they cannot agree with each other, they are required to change their position.

Appeal

If you're an injured worker and you are denied access to benefits under workers' compensation, you can request an appeal. This process can be laborious and time-consuming, which is why it is crucial to seek the assistance of a skilled workers compensation lawyer.

The first step to appeals is to complete the appropriate form and documentation. The time frame for appealing a denial differs by state, but typically starts after you've received the first denial notice.

If you file an appeal the appeal will be reviewed and re-examined by a Board composed of three workers legal judges. The panel may either affirm, modify or reverse the original decision.

A full Board review is the last appeal at the administrative level. It will examine the whole case to decide if it should affirm or uphold the Judge's decision alter or reverse that Judge's decision, or even return the case for further hearings.

If the Board panel is not satisfied with the Judge's decision, an appeal can be filed within 30 days with the Appellate Division, Third Department, Supreme Court of New York. The Court of Appeals can then appeal the decision of the Appellate Division.

Final Hearing

A worker's comp hearing is where an individual judge reviews your claim and determines whether you are eligible. The hearings could last anywhere from several weeks to several years depending on the complexity and the extent of your case.

During the hearing, a claimant might be asked to submit medical evidence to support their case, including medical reports and other evidence. Your lawyer may also be able to engage a medical professional to give evidence before the judge.

After the judge makes an order, the claimant can appeal to the Workers Compensation Board or an appellate court. Your attorney can guide you through this process as well as other steps of the timeline for litigation.

In some instances it is possible for a settlement to be reached at this stage. The final settlement is typically an agreement between the insurance company and you.

The settlement agreement will be reviewed by a judge, who will ensure that the terms are reasonable and fair to you considering your injuries. The settlement agreement will be ratified by the judge, and your workers' compensation lawsuit timeline will end.

However, if not satisfied with the judge's ruling, your case can be taken to an appellate level , where a three-member panel will review the evidence presented by both sides and make a decision. The panel's decision could affirm, modify, or rescind the decision of a previous judge.
